Abstract

The present utility model provides a portable cosmetic instrument, comprising: the electronic device comprises a shell, an electrode, a processing circuit and a first key assembly, wherein the electrode is at least partially exposed on the surface of the shell; the processing circuit is positioned in the shell and connected with the electrode; the first key assembly is at least partially exposed to the housing surface and is connected to the processing circuit. In the above manner, the first key assembly is connected with the processing circuit, and the first key assembly controls the processing circuit, and then the processing circuit controls the current and/or the voltage output to the electrode.

Referring to fig. 1 and 2, fig. 1 is a schematic view of a first accommodating space of an embodiment of the portable beauty treatment device of the present utility model, fig. 2 is a schematic view of a first key assembly of an embodiment of the portable beauty treatment device of the present utility model shown in fig. 1, and fig. 3 is a schematic view of a first key assembly of an embodiment of the portable beauty treatment device of the present utility model shown in fig. 2. In these figures, the portable cosmetic device comprises: the electronic device comprises a shell, an electrode 100, a processing circuit 1400 and a first key assembly 200, wherein the electrode 100 is at least partially exposed on the surface of the shell so as to contact skin; the processing circuit 1400 is located in the housing and is connected to the electrode 100; the first key assembly 200 is at least partially exposed to the housing surface (the portion of the first case assembly 200 at the top is at least partially exposed to the housing surface) and is connected to the processing circuitry 1400.
The user switches different operation modes or gear positions through the first key assembly 200, at this time, the first key assembly 200 sends a signal to the processing circuit 1400, and the processing circuit 1400 controls the current and/or voltage output to the electrode 100 according to the received signal, so that the electrode 100 is switched to the corresponding operation mode or power output gear position.
The first key assembly 200 includes a key circuit board 210, a key body 220, a key case 230, and at least two light emitting elements 240, wherein the key circuit board 210 is connected to the processing circuit 1400; the light-emitting element 240 is connected to the key circuit board 210 and/or the processing circuit 1400 for indicating an operation state; the key body 220 is disposed opposite to the key circuit board 210, the key case 230 covers the key body 220 and the light emitting element 240, and the key body 220 and the light emitting element 240 are mounted on the key circuit board 210; the key case 230 includes a light-transmitting body at least at a portion of the top and a light-shielding body at least at a portion of the sidewall.
Optionally, at least a portion of the key case 230 at the top is a light transmissive body.
In the present embodiment, the second post 238 and the third post 239 protrude below the key case 230, and ribs are provided in the second post 238 and the third post 239, which divide the third post 239 into different compartments.
Wherein, the key body 220 can be embedded into the second post 238, and the rib inside the second post 238 contacts the key case 230, and the key body 220 can be triggered by pressing the key case 230 above the key body 220; the number of compartments at the bottom of the third column 239 is the same as the number of light emitting elements 240 on the key circuit board 210, and the light emitted by each light emitting element 240 can be emitted from the corresponding compartment.
Therefore, the second post 238 below the key case 230 can fix the key case 230 on the key case 220, and the rib inside the second post 238 contacts the key case 230, so that when the user presses the corresponding portion of the key case 230 above the key case 220, the key case 230 is recessed downward, and then the rib inside the second post 238 presses the trigger key case 220. Accordingly, the user can trigger the key body 220 by pressing the key case 230 above the key body 220.
Meanwhile, the third column 239 under the key case 230 may fix the key case 230 to the light emitting elements 240, and the rib divides the third column 239 into different compartments, the number of which corresponds to the light emitting elements 240, each of the light emitting elements 240 being placed in a different compartment. Thus, the light emitted by each light emitting element 240 can be emitted from the corresponding compartment, and the light gathering function is performed.
In the related art, the key (key body 220) and the indicator lamp (light emitting element 240) of the cosmetic instrument are separately provided, resulting in poor structure. The present utility model has an optimized structure and a relatively simple structure because the key (key body 220) and the light emitting element (light emitting element 240) indicating the operation state are integrated together.
When the user presses the key body 220 in the first key assembly 200 to trigger, the working mode and/or the gear of the beauty instrument can be switched according to the key circuit board 210 corresponding to the key body 220, the key circuit board 210 sends the key information generated by the corresponding key body 220 to the processing circuit 1400, and meanwhile, the key circuit controls the light emitting element 240 to emit light, and different key information corresponding lights can be different, for example: in the one-shift pull mode, only one light emitting element 240 emits red light; in the two-gear rf mode, two light emitting elements 240 emit blue light. Meanwhile, the processing circuit 1400 controls the cosmetic instrument to switch to a corresponding working mode and/or gear according to the key information.
Further, the key case 230 is composed of a key case cover 231 and a key case 232, and the key case 232 has a light-transmitting hole 233 corresponding to the light-emitting element 240 of the first key assembly 200 except for the top thereof, and the rest is light-proof; the entirety of the key case cover 231 is a light-transmitting member.
The light emitted by the light emitting element 240 can be emitted through the corresponding light hole 233, and then the light emitting condition of the light emitting element 240 is checked through the housing cover 231.
Wherein, the upper part of the key case cover 231 is provided with a limit column 234 corresponding to a guide groove 235 at the upper part of the key case 232; and the lower part of the key housing cover 231 is provided with a positioning block 236 corresponding to a notch 237 at the lower part of the key housing 232.
The upper part of the keycap 231 is provided with a limit column 234, and the lower part of the keycap 231 is provided with a positioning block 236; and the upper part of the key shell 232 is provided with a guide groove 235, and the lower part of the key shell 232 is provided with a notch 237;
the key housing 232 and the key housing cover 231 can be fixed by inserting the stopper posts 234 on the upper part of the key housing cover 231 into the guide grooves 235 on the upper part of the key housing 232 while the positioning blocks 236 on the lower part of the key housing 231 are inserted into the notches 237 on the lower part of the key housing 232.
When the key body 220 is pressed, the key circuit board 210 below the key body 220 receives the information, and then controls the light emitting element 240 above the key circuit board 210 to emit different light. The number and the positions of the light emitting elements 240 vertically correspond to the light holes 233 of the key housing 232, so that the light emitted by the light emitting elements 240 will be emitted through the corresponding light holes 233, and the light transmission condition of the light holes 233 of the key housing 232 is checked through the integral light-transmitting key housing cover 231.
Therefore, in the process of checking the light transmission condition of the light transmission hole 233 of the key housing 232 through the key housing cover 231, the key housing cover 231 and the key housing 232 can weaken the brightness of the light emitted by the light emitting element 240, so that the light is prevented from being too dazzling, and the user can clearly check the light emitting condition of the light emitting element 240, and the light is soft and comfortable.
Meanwhile, the portion of the key case 230 corresponding to the light emitting element 240 has a light guide channel, and the periphery of the light guide channel is a light shielding body.
In the embodiment of the present utility model, the number and the positions of the light emitting elements 240 correspond to the light transmitting holes 233 of the key housing 232, and the key housing cover 231 and the key housing 232 have protruding arc-shaped bars corresponding to the light emitting elements 240, and the protruding arc-shaped bars may function to collect light. Therefore, the light guide channel means that the light of each light emitting element 240 is emitted from each compartment of the third column 239 below the key housing 230, passes through the light transmission hole 233 on the corresponding key housing 232, and passes through the integral light-transmitting key housing cover 231. The key housing 232 is opaque except for the light holes 233 (the periphery of the key housing 232 is light shielding).
Therefore, in the present embodiment, the light emitted by the light emitting element 240 is emitted through the light guide channel, so that the light is more concentrated in the irradiation process under the condition that the light is prevented from being too glaring, and the user can clearly view the light emitted by the light emitting element 240 through the key case 230.
Optionally, the top of the key case 230 is a translucent case, and is configured to block the outside vision when the light emitting element 240 does not emit light, so that the inside structure is not visible to the human eye, and at least part of the light is transmitted when the light emitting element 240 emits light. Therefore, when the light emitting element 240 does not emit light, no light is emitted from the top of the key case 230, so that human eyes are not disturbed, and the appearance of the beauty instrument is ensured; when the light emitting element 240 emits light, a part of the light is transmitted through the top of the key case 230. In addition, the top surface of the key case 230 is a plating surface or a spraying surface, which can weaken the brightness of light, not stimulate human eyes, and embody high-grade feeling.
Optionally, the key body 220 and the key shell 230 are integrally formed, so that the key is triggered more sensitively, and the integrated structure makes the structure more excellent, so that gaps between the key body 220 and the key shell 230 are reduced, the sealing performance is improved, and the waterproof and dustproof capabilities are improved.
In this embodiment, by switching different working modes or output powers through the key assembly, the electrode 100 can be controlled to generate micro-current and radio-frequency current to stimulate skin, and the skin can be improved by means of illuminating skin light by a phototherapy lamp, for example, at least any one of the cosmetic effects of rapid lifting, powerful anti-aging, popping and tightening, 3-minute V-face, fading of stature, tightening and molding of eyes, strengthening of skin barrier, tendering and brightening can be achieved.
Referring to fig. 4 and 5, fig. 4 is a schematic view of a middle frame structure of an embodiment of the portable beauty apparatus of the present utility model, and fig. 5 is a schematic view of a front shell of an embodiment of the portable beauty apparatus of the present utility model. In fig. 4 and 5, the portable beauty instrument includes a middle frame 300, the middle frame 300 having a first mounting plate 310 extending in a first direction 10 and a second mounting plate 320 extending in a second direction 20, the first mounting plate 310 having a first side 311 and a second side 312 disposed opposite to each other, and a third side 313 (hidden by the second mounting plate 320) connecting between the first side 311 and the second side 312, the second mounting plate 320 having a first side and a second side disposed opposite to each other, the second mounting plate 320 being connected to the third side 313 of the first mounting plate 310 by the first side.
Optionally, the third side 313 of the first mounting plate 310 is connected to an intermediate position of the second mounting plate 320.
Alternatively, the first direction 10 and the second direction 20 are perpendicular. Generally, the first direction 10 is parallel to the central axis of the portable cosmetic instrument and the second direction 20 is perpendicular to the central axis of the portable cosmetic instrument.
Alternatively, the first mounting plate 310 and the second mounting plate 320 may be substantially plate bodies, or may be frame bodies with concave-convex structures, or may be hollow structures. The main meaning of extending in the first direction 10 and/or the second direction 20 herein may refer to the plane of the board body extending in the first direction 10 and/or the second direction 20, or the plane of the contour formed by the side edges of the first mounting plate 310 and/or the second mounting plate 320 extending in the first direction 10 and/or the second direction 20.
The case includes a front case 400, a first side case 500, and a second side case 600, the first side case 500 and the second side case 600 being respectively mounted at opposite sides of the first mounting plate 310, and constituting a first receiving space 1500 (see fig. 6) and a second receiving space 1600 (see fig. 6) separated by the first mounting plate 310 together with the second mounting plate 320.
The front case 400 is disposed opposite to the second side of the second mounting plate 320, and forms a third accommodating space 1700 (see fig. 6) with the second mounting plate 320, and the processing circuit 1400 is located in the first accommodating space 1500 (see fig. 6), the second accommodating space 1600 (see fig. 6), or the third accommodating space 1700 (see fig. 6).
The portable cosmetic instrument takes a middle frame 300 as a main body, a first side shell 500, a second side shell 600 and a front shell 400 are spliced at different positions of the middle frame 300, and the first side shell 500, the second side shell 600 and the front shell 400 form a shell of the portable cosmetic instrument together with a first side 311, a second side 312 and a side exposed by a second mounting plate 320, which are exposed by a first mounting plate 310.
Therefore, the first side case 500 and the second side case 600 are spliced together by the middle frame 300, so that the assembly of the beauty instrument can be facilitated, and the shapes of the first side case 500 and the second side case 600 are approximately the same, so that the casings of the beauty instrument are in a more regular shape, and a user can grasp the beauty instrument better.
Referring to fig. 6, fig. 6 is a side sectional view of a housing of an embodiment of the portable beauty treatment instrument of the present utility model. In this figure, the first side case 500 and the second side case 600 are collectively referred to as side cases, and the side cases have two opposite depressions, that is, the first side case 500 and the second side case 600 each have one depression, and the front case 400 has an annular groove adjacent to the side case, and the depressions and the annular groove conform to the ergonomics, so that the user can hold the beauty instrument during use, and avoid slipping.
Alternatively, the portable beauty treatment instrument has three receiving spaces, the first mounting plate 310, the first side case 500 and the second mounting plate 320 constitute a first receiving space 1500, the first mounting plate 310, the second side case 600 and the second mounting plate 320 constitute a second receiving space 1600, the front case 400 and the second mounting plate 320 constitute a third receiving space 1700, and the electrode 100 is disposed in the front case 400.
In another embodiment of the present utility model, the portable cosmetic instrument includes a processing circuit 1400, an energy storage circuit 1800, a charging circuit 1900, the energy storage circuit 1800 storing energy required by the portable cosmetic instrument; the charging circuit 1900 inputs energy to the tank circuit 1800.
The tank circuit 1800 is disposed in the first accommodating space 1500, and the processing circuit 1400 and the charging circuit 1900 are disposed in the second accommodating space 1600.
Different components are placed in different accommodating spaces of the portable beauty instrument, so that the temperature of the components can be prevented from rising in the working process, the normal working conditions of other components are affected, and each component can be better fixed in the portable beauty instrument.
Alternatively, the tank circuit 1800 may be a capacitor, a battery, or the like.
Referring to fig. 7, fig. 7 is a schematic diagram of a middle frame structure of another embodiment of the portable beauty apparatus of the utility model. In this figure, the middle frame 300 further includes a third mounting plate 700 disposed on a side of the first mounting plate 310 opposite to the third side 313, and extending along the second direction 20. And the first key assembly 200 is disposed on a side of the third mounting plate 700 opposite to the second mounting plate 320.
In the operation process of the portable beauty instrument, since the first key assembly 200 and the electrode 100 are disposed at two ends of the portable beauty instrument and assembled in opposite directions, the user can not randomly switch the operation mode and/or gear of the portable beauty instrument due to easy touch and press in the process of using the portable beauty instrument, thereby being convenient for the user to use better.
Referring to fig. 8, fig. 8 is a schematic view of a bottom case of a portable beauty treatment apparatus according to an embodiment of the utility model. In this figure, the housing further comprises: the bottom case 900 covers the third mounting plate 700 and is located between the first and second side cases 500 and 600, the bottom case 900 has a first through hole 1110 to expose the key case 230, and the key case 230 protrudes out of the first through hole 1110.
Alternatively, the first key assembly 200 may be exposed to the bottom chassis 900 in various forms. For example: the top of the key case 230 is exposed outside the bottom case 900; the keys of the first key assembly 200 are exposed outside the bottom case 900, while the indicator lamps are embedded inside the bottom case 900, and a user checks how many indicator lamps are emitting light through the transparent member or the through hole on the bottom case 900; the keys and the indicator lights of the first key assembly 200 are embedded in the bottom case 900, etc.
Therefore, the user can control the opening and/or closing of the cosmetic instrument or switch different operation modes and gears, etc., through the first key assembly 200 protruding in the first through hole 1110.
Referring to fig. 1 and 7, fig. 1 is a schematic view of a first accommodating space of an embodiment of the portable beauty apparatus of the utility model, and fig. 7 is a schematic view of a middle frame of another embodiment of the portable beauty apparatus of the utility model. In fig. 1 and 7, the portable cosmetic instrument further includes: the fourth mounting board 800 and the light emitting circuit board 810, the fourth mounting board 800 is disposed on a side of the first mounting board 310 opposite to the third side 313, and extends along the third direction 30. The light-emitting circuit board 810 is disposed on a side of the fourth mounting board 800 opposite to the second mounting board 320, and a plurality of indicator lamps are disposed on a side of the light-emitting circuit board 810 facing the bottom case 900.
Therefore, the fourth mounting board 800 is adjacent to the third mounting board 700 and is disposed at an included angle, so that the display structure and the key control structure are disposed adjacent to the periphery of the circular or approximately circular housing, so that the user can see the corresponding light indication when operating the portable cosmetic device, thereby facilitating the use of the portable cosmetic device.
The first direction 10, the second direction 20, and the third direction 30 are different from each other, the bottom case 900 is provided with a plurality of transparent patterns corresponding to the plurality of indicator lamps, and the plurality of indicator lamps are used for indicating different beauty modes.
The light of a plurality of pilot lamps is sent out through drain pan 900, can see how many pilot lamps are shining, also can prevent that the light that the pilot lamp sent from being too dazzling, weakens light, makes the user see softer light.
Optionally, the portable beauty instrument further includes: the second key assembly 1000 is disposed on the key circuit board 210.
The first key assembly 200 and the second key assembly 1000 are arranged on the same key circuit board 210, so that the cost of the circuit board can be saved, the assembly is more convenient, and the structure is simpler.
Alternatively, the first key assembly 200 and the second key assembly 1000 are respectively disposed on different key circuit boards.
Therefore, the light emitting circuit board 810 is mounted on the fourth mounting board 800, and the light emitted by the indicator light on the light emitting circuit board 810 will be irradiated out through the bottom case 900, when the user turns on and/or off the cosmetic apparatus or switches different operation modes and gear positions through the first key assembly 200 and the second key assembly 1000, the current operation mode and operation state of the cosmetic apparatus can be determined by the light emitted by the indicator light in the bottom case 900, for example: the user can turn on and/or turn off the beauty instrument by pressing the second key assembly 1000 for a long time and reaching a preset time, when the beauty instrument is turned on, the second key assembly 1000 emits white light, and when the beauty instrument is turned off, the second key assembly 1000 does not emit light; or when the beauty instrument is turned on, the default working mode is a skin lifting mode, at this time, the second key assembly 1000 is white light, and when the user switches the working mode to a radio frequency mode, the second key assembly 1000 is red light; or when the operation mode is the skin lifting mode and the second key assembly 1000 is white light, if the default gear is the first gear, only one of the light emitting elements 240 of the first key assembly 200 emits light, and meanwhile, the light emitting circuit board 810 also emits light only with one indicator light, and when the user presses the first key assembly 200 to adjust the gear to the second gear, at this time, the light emitting elements 240 of the first key assembly 200 emit light with two lights, and the light emitting circuit board 810 also emits light with two indicator lights.
Referring to fig. 3, fig. 3 is a schematic diagram of a first key assembly of the portable beauty treatment apparatus according to an embodiment of the utility model shown in fig. 2. In fig. 3, one end of the key case 230 is connected to one side of the first through hole 1110, and the other end of the key case 230 is a free end. The first key assembly 200 includes an elastic member 2000, and the elastic member 2000 is connected between the free end of the key case 230 and the bottom case 900.
The bottom case 900 has a plurality of first pillars 910 on a side facing the key case 230, the elastic member 2000 has holes, and the first pillars 910 are inserted into the holes of the elastic member 2000, so that the first key assembly 200 is fixed to the bottom case 900.
Meanwhile, the bottom case 900 has a second through hole 1120, the second key assembly 1000 protrudes out of the second through hole 1120, and the bottom case 900 and the second key assembly 1000 are also fixed through the first column 910 and the plurality of holes on the elastic member 2000.
Accordingly, the user can control the on/off of the cosmetic instrument or switch different operation modes and gears, etc., through the first key assembly 200, the second key assembly 1000 protruding in the first through hole 1110, the second through hole 1120.
In another embodiment of the present utility model, the portable beauty instrument includes an annular housing 1200, the annular housing 1200 being positioned between the front housing 400 and the second mounting plate 320 to space the front housing 400, the second mounting plate 320.
Optionally, the front case 400, the annular case 1200, and the second mounting plate 320 form a third accommodating space 1700, the interposer 1300 is disposed in the third accommodating space 1700, and the interposer 1300 is connected to the electrode 100.
Referring to fig. 9 and 10, fig. 9 is a schematic circuit diagram of an embodiment of the portable beauty apparatus of the present utility model, and fig. 10 is an enlarged partial sectional view of a side surface of a housing of another embodiment of the portable beauty apparatus of the present utility model shown in fig. 6. In fig. 9 and 10, the processing circuit 1400 outputs a radio frequency current or micro-current to the electrode 100 through the patch panel 1300.
